NY, NJ And Connecticut Order Visitors From New COVID Hot Spots To Quarantine

NY, NJ And Connecticut Order Visitors From New COVID Hot Spots To Quarantine

New York, New Jersey and Connecticut will need individuals from other states with a high portion of new COVID-19 cases to self-quarantine for 2 weeks upon going into the 3 states, their guvs announced Wednesday.

The travel mandate enters into impact at midnight and affects tourists from states with a “favorable test rate greater than 10 per 100,000 homeowners over a 7-day rolling average or a state with a 10%or higher positivity rate over a 7-day rolling average,” stated New York Gov. Andrew Cuomo (D) at an afternoon interview.

The states meeting that requirements on Wednesday were: Alabama, Arkansas, Arizona, Florida, North Carolina, South Carolina, Washington, Utah and Texas. States can be added or eliminated from this list based on their infection rate, Cuomo stated.

All people traveling from states with substantial neighborhood spread of COVID into NY, NJ, or CT needs to quarantine for 14 days.
